Words That Rhyme With Evil
- Medieval – Referring to the Middle Ages, a period in European history between the 5th and 15th centuries. This era is known for its knights, castles, and feudal systems.
- Primeval – Of or relating to the earliest ages of the world, before the appearance of humans. This word is often used to describe ancient forests or other natural landscapes.
- Retrieval – The act of retrieving or recovering something that was lost or taken. This could refer to anything from lost keys to a stolen artifact.
- Upheaval – A sudden and dramatic change or disruption. This could refer to a political upheaval, a geological upheaval, or any other significant event that causes upheaval.
- Weevil – A small beetle-like insect that is known for damaging crops and stored food. Weevils are often found in grains, nuts, and seeds.
